为了账号安全,请及时绑定邮箱和手机立即绑定

vue切换页面的时候渲染不同的菜单

vue切换页面的时候渲染不同的菜单

陪伴而非守候 2018-11-17 18:16:43
App.vue的结构如下<div id="app"><Header /><Menu /><div>     <router-view/></div></div>Header.vue的结构<div><li><router-link to="/a">页面a</router-link></li><li><router-link to="/b">页面b</router-link></li></div>Menu.vue的结构<div><!-- 页面a显示页面a的菜单 --><ul>     <li>页面a的菜单1</li>     <li>页面a的菜单2</li></ul><!-- 页面b显示页面a的菜单 --><ul>     <li>页面b的菜单1</li>     <li>页面b的菜单2</li></ul></div>想实现点击header导航,跳转到不同页面,页面a显示菜单a,页面b显示菜单b。请问这种怎么解决呢?
查看完整描述

1 回答

?
qq_花开花谢_0

TA贡献1835条经验 获得超7个赞

当你导航页检测路由的变化
进行条件判断来改变菜单

查看完整回答
反对 回复 2018-11-17
  • 1 回答
  • 0 关注
  • 1791 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信